Femtocell Challenges

How does the Femtocell fit in the RAN?100Ks of Node-Bs attached to RNC / BSC / ASNCollapsed stackConnects to broadband (no backhaul timing available)

CostNeeds to have a BOM of $100-$200Needs to have a BOM of $100-$200Cheap baseband processing, RF and oscillator needed

Other technical challengesQoSHandoverProvisioningInterference mitigation

Industry is solving these issuesIndustry is solving these issuespicoChip will reflect these in our reference designs

WiMAX needs femtocells even more than 3G

WiMAX is at higher frequency: worse coverageWiMAX is predicated on high-speed data2.5GHz and 64QAM will not go well through wallsCoverage

Users are guaranteed coverage at their homeFemtocells can cover the surrounding area outside building

Building penetration60-70% of mobile usage is in-buildingQPSK modulation and strong FEC needed for building penetration –QPSK modulation and strong FEC needed for building penetration –reduces overall cell capacity

CapacityMacrocell: Typ 30 Mbps shared between 100 usersF t ll 10 Mb h d b t 3 5Femtocell: >10 Mbps shared between 3-5 users

Cost$100 for femtocell vs $10,000 for macrocellCheap backhaul via DSL cable or fibre – consumer pays!
